How do I find my Mercedes me ID?

You may try your myMBFS email or your registered phone number. Unfortunately, Mercedes me has yet to provide “Forgot ID” feature. If you already linked your Mercedes me ID to myMBFS portal previously, Customer service center may assist you in this case. You can reset your PIN (Personal Identification Number) by pressing the i-Button in the vehicle or by calling the Mercedes Me® Response Center toll-free at 866-990-9007.

What is a Mercedes-Benz ID?

The Mercedes me ID service enables you to create a single user account to login to all websites and applications of Mercedes-Benz USA, LLC and the Mercedes-Benz Group linked to this service. Your user account and password give you personalized access to the corresponding websites and applications. Mercedes Me is free for everyone, regardless of your vehicle or Mercedes Me® account status.
